Transaction 38bcd3e992126c07e494bdd033b2cec6f3724e42631116e5e0b05355666bafc7
1 Input
1 Output
-
38bcd3e992126c07e494bdd033b2cec6f3724e42631116e5e0b05355666bafc7:0
- value
- 1854970
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cda505963da0382ac79c8a445aa0dde8add194e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q3xp4ACwsn662zoUzwo6N5eNvLR7oHUbN